Humanae Vitae 50th Anniversary Series – Leila Lawler

In his letter dates 25 July 1968, His Holiness, Pope Paul VI, stated: The transmission of human life is a most serious role in which married people collaborate freely and responsibly with God the Creator. It has always been a source of great joy to them, even though it sometimes entails many difficulties and hardships.

Followed by a talk by Leila Lawler
